Photographers, audio-visual and broadcasting equipment operators vs Welfare and Housing Associate Professionals Salary (2025)

How do Photographers, audio-visual and broadcasting equipment operators and Welfare and Housing Associate Professionals salaries compare in the UK? Here is a detailed side-by-side breakdown.

Photographers, audio-visual and broadcasting equipment operators earns £2,943 more per year (10% higher)
vs

Detailed Comparison

MetricPhotographers, audio-visual and broadcasting equipment operatorsWelfare and Housing Associate ProfessionalsDifference
Median Annual£32,002£29,059+£2,943
Mean Annual£32,586£28,365+£4,221
Monthly£2,667£2,422+£245
Weekly£615£559+£56
Hourly£15.39£13.97+£1.42

Salary Range Comparison

PercentilePhotographers, audio-visual and broadcasting equipment operatorsWelfare and Housing Associate Professionals
10th (Entry)£14,376£13,269
25th£25,954£22,067
50th (Median)£32,002£29,059
75th£38,201£35,023
